Sunteți pe pagina 1din 19

Universidad tecnolgica de Tehuacan ING: Tecnologas de la Informacin y Comunicacin Base de Datos para plicaciones !

anual de Base de Datos Distri"uida #$ % &

'orge Garca !(nde)

Una Base de Datos Distribuida es construida sobre una red computacional, entonces es una coleccin de datos que pertenecen lgicamente a un slo sistema, pero se encuentra fsicamente esparcido en varios "sitios" de la red. El siguiente manual nos ayudar a comprender la configuracin para realizar una base de datos distribuidas con la configuracin de master master, los cuales utilizaran un gestor de base de datos por medio de !y"#$. %rimero mencionaremos los requisitos que necesitaremos para la configuracin, como es &ard'are y soft'are. (equisit os Dos pc con sistema operativo )indo's *

+estor de base de datos este caso utilizaremos ,-pp"erv,

en

. "'itc& de / puertos

0 cables de red directos

$o primero que tenemos que &acer es instalar -pp"erv en los equipos de cmputo, este programa instala los servicios de "+DB.

-qu mostraremos el diagrama de red que estaremos utilizando.

Enseguida para proceder con la configuracin de 1%, esto se &ace entrando al %anel de control, despu2s, redes e internet, centro de redes y recursos compartidos. Esta es la ruta3 %anel de control4(edes e 1nternet45entro de redes y recursos compartidos. Estando aqu lo siguiente ser6 entrar a cone7in de 6rea local para configurar la 1%.

Figura 1 conexin de rea local

-qu mostraremos el diagrama de red que estaremos utilizando.

Figura 3 Propiedades de conexin de rea local

-l dar clic8 nos aparece la ventana de Estado de 5one7in de 6rea local y entraremos a propiedades.

Figura 2 Estado de conexin de rea local

Entrando a propiedades nos despliega la ventana de %ropiedades de cone7in de 6rea local y es en esta seleccionaremos %rotocolo de internet versin 9:;5%<1%v9=.

Figura 1 conexin de rea local

5onfiguramos la 1% como se muestra en las dos siguientes figuras

Figura ! "on#iguracin de $P del %aster 1

Figura 8 Ubicacin del archivo m

- continuacin verificamos si &ay cone7in entre las dos %5 desde 5!D a los equipos conectados a la red

Figura ' Ping del %aster 1 a Esclavo 1

Figura ( Ping del Esclavo 1 al %aster 1 Despu2s de comprobar la conectividad y ya verificando que este correcta, buscamos el arc&ivo my.ini el cual se encuentra en la siguiente direccin 534-pp"erv4!y"#$ seleccionamos el arc&ivo my el cual es un bloc de >otas.

Figura & "on#iguracin de $P del Esclavo 1

-qu se muestra lo que realizara el

$e damos los datos del master ?, y el nombre la contrase@a del master . , y que se utilizara en el esclavo . y en el master ..

Figura ) *rchivo % %aster 1

del

Dentro del arc&ivo my configuramos el nombre de la base de datos

Figura 1+ "on#iguracin del *rchivo m del master 1

- continuacin configuraremos el my del esclavo . que se encuentra en la siguiente direccin 534-pp"erv4!y"#$

Figura 11 "on#iguracin de los datos de host, contrase-a, usuario la base de datos con la .ue se va a replicar - continuacin configuraremos el arc&ivo my &uge del esclavo . que se encuentra en la siguiente direccin 534-pp"erv4!y"#$

Figura12 "on#iguracin de los datos del host, contrase-a de datos .ue se va a replicar

base

Aa teniendo esto configurado, se reinicia el servidor de !y"#$, para que se realicen los cambios, como se muestra en la siguiente figura.

Figura 13 /einicio del servicio % 012 Despu2s nos vamos a configurar el !aster . desde consola !y"#$. 5reamos un usuario llamado (E%$15-51B> y la contrase@a es .?0, esto solo se realizara en el !aster . y se le dar6 todos los privilegios, como se muestra en la siguiente figura.

Figura 1! "reamos el usuario privilegios

damos

- continuacin realizaremos un respaldo de nuestra base de datos

Figura 1& *ntes de reali3ar el respaldo

Figura 1' /espaldo de la base de datos Aa teniendo el respaldo se desbloquean las tablas y se consulta el contenido del master . y nos proporcionara estos datos.

Figura 1( 4os proporciona la posicin del %aster 1

el expediente

- continuacin paceremos a la configuracin del esclavo . -qu configuraremos el esclavo . en modo consola a !y"#$, como se muestra en la siguiente figura.

Figura 18 Esclavo 1

El otro usuario nos tendr6 que pasar el respaldo de la base de datos

Figura 1) 5ase de datos - continuacin se para el esclavo como se muestra en la siguiente figura

Figura 2+ Parar el esclavo 5omo se muestra en la siguiente figura no se encuentra la base de datos con la que trabaCaremos.

Figura 21 6isuali3acin de la tabla de base de datos

- continuacin crearemos la base de datos

Figura 22 "reacin de la base de datos "e inicia el esclavo . para los fluCos

Figura 23 iniciar el esclavo 1 "e muestra el estado del esclavo, como aDn no tenemos conectividad podemos observar

Figura 2! Estado del esclavo

%aramos de nuevo el esclavo y reseteamos el esclavo para una nueva ubicacin como se muestra en la siguiente figura

7e Figura 2& 0top esclavo

reset del

- continuacin introduciremos la ubicacin y el fic&ero para que se conecten como se muestra en la siguiente figura

Figura 2' "onectividad del %aster - continuacin realizaremos unas pruebas para verificar la conectividad, donde se modificara un registro del !aster al esclavo y solo el esclavo podr6 visualizar lo realizado como muestra en la siguiente figura

Figura 2( Primer prueba

- continuacin configuraremos de !aster E !aster %rimero tendremos que dar privilegios al usuario como mostraremos en la siguiente figura

Figura 28 "reamos el usuario privilegios (einiciamos el servicio de !y"#$.

damos

Figura 2) /einicio del % 012 1niciamos el esclavo como se muestra en la siguiente figura

Figura 3+ 0e inicia el esclavo

%onemos el siguiente comando ,s&o' master status para verificar la posicin y nombre del arc&ivo.

Figura 31 Posicin nombre del archivo El master nuevamente eCecuta el comando stop "lave y iniciamos el esclavo como se muestra en las siguientes figuras

Figura 32 Parar el esclavo

Figura 33 $niciamos el esclavo - continuacin mostraremos el estado del esclavo con el siguiente comando s&o' "lave status

Figura 3! 6isuali3acin del estado del esclavo

Aa realizado toda esta configuracin de !aster !aster continuamos con las pruebas. El master insertara el dato con el nDmero .9 y consultara la tabla como en la figura 0/. Despu2s el master realizara un datos con el nDmero de registro .0, y se realiza una consulta como se muestra en la figura 0F.

Figura 3& %aster8%aster esclavo

Figura 3' %aster8 %aster

5onclusin Este documento muestra la aventura que se empez al realizar la pr6ctica de base de datos distribuidos, no se saba realizar porque nunca antes se &aba trabaCado con esto, se aprendi y se realiz, estudiando se logr &acer, esto deCo una gran ense@anza al trabaCar con esta parte de la base de datos.

S-ar putea să vă placă și